What to Consider Before Buying Electronic Drum Pads

Electronic Drum Pads are more than just an item; it’s a key solution for bridging the gap between musical ambition and the practical constraints of modern living. These devices offer a way to practice timing, limb coordination, and rhythm without requiring a dedicated room in your house. For a beginner, they provide an affordable entry point into the world of percussion, allowing them to test the waters before committing to a multi-thousand-dollar investment. For the seasoned player, they serve as a portable practice tool that can be rolled up and taken on the go. To maximize the benefit, one must look for a balance between pad sensitivity, sound variety, and connectivity options.

The ideal customer for this type of product is someone facing space limitations, parents of young children (around ages 5 to 12) looking for an engaging musical gift, or hobbyists who need a quiet way to practice late at night. While these pads are fantastic for learning and casual play, they might not be suitable for professional session drummers looking for high-end trigger accuracy or those who require the rebound physics of a real Mylar drumhead. If you are looking for professional studio recording gear, you might consider higher-end rack-mounted electronic kits instead.

Before investing, consider these crucial points in detail:

  • Dimensions & Space: Consider where the pad will be used. A roll-up design is essential for those who need to clear the kitchen table after practice. Look for a set that offers a large enough striking surface to mimic a standard layout while remaining compact enough to fit in a backpack.
  • Capacity/Performance: This refers to the “brain” of the drum set. You want a variety of pre-loaded tones and rhythms. Check the battery life; a 10-hour runtime is the gold standard for portable units, ensuring that the music doesn’t stop halfway through a practice session because of a dead battery.
  • Materials & Durability: Most portable pads use silicone. You want high-quality, waterproof silicone that can withstand thousands of strikes from wooden drumsticks. Thin materials may tear or lose sensitivity over time, so the thickness and tactile response of the pads are vital for a realistic feel.
  • Ease of Use & Maintenance: The interface should be intuitive enough for a child to use without a manual. Additionally, consider how easy it is to clean. Since these pads often sit on the floor or tables, a waterproof surface that can be wiped down is a major plus for long-term hygiene.

A Deep Dive into the Performance of the EKEMOND 9-Piece Electronic Drum Set with Built-in Speaker

Tactile Response and Pad Layout Performance

When we first sat down to put the EKEMOND 9-Piece Electronic Drum Set with Built-in Speaker through its paces, I focused heavily on the pad sensitivity. In the world of electronic drums, “latency” and “dead zones” are the enemies of progress. I was pleasantly surprised to find that the 9 pads are quite responsive. Whether you are using the included wooden drumsticks or practicing finger-drumming, the silicone surface registers strikes with minimal delay. The layout is intelligently designed; the crashes and ride are positioned at the top, while the snare and toms sit lower, encouraging the correct muscle memory that a beginner will eventually need when transitioning to a full-sized kit.

One detail we noticed during our testing is that the pads require a relatively “clean” hit in the center to trigger the maximum volume. This is actually a benefit for learners, as it teaches precision. If you are looking for a device that can help a child develop the coordination between their left and right hands, this is a fantastic tool. Sound Quality and Internal “Brain” Features

The “brain” of any electronic kit is its internal sound module. The EKEMOND 9-Piece Electronic Drum Set with Built-in Speaker comes pre-loaded with 6 different tones, 10 rhythms, and 12 demo songs. In our experience, the tones range from classic acoustic drum sounds to more synthesized, “electro” beats. This variety is crucial because it keeps the practice sessions from becoming monotonous. We found that the built-in dual stereo speakers do a commendable job of filling a bedroom with sound without the need for an external amplifier. However, the real magic happens when you use the 3.5mm headphone jack. This allows for near-silent practice, which is the primary reason many people buy this set in the first place.

We did observe, confirming some user feedback, that the balance between sounds can be a bit quirky. For instance, the snare and toms are quite bright and loud, while the kick drum (controlled by the pedal) can feel a bit recessed in the mix depending on the “style” you have selected. However, for a practice tool under $100, the fidelity is more than adequate. Advanced Connectivity: MIDI and Beyond

For those who want to take their drumming beyond simple practice, the USB MIDI connection is a game-changer. By connecting the EKEMOND 9-Piece Electronic Drum Set with Built-in Speaker to a computer or a smartphone, you can use it as a controller for software like GarageBand or various MIDI-compatible drum games. This opens up an infinite library of sounds and learning tools. In our evaluation, the MIDI connection was stable, with very low latency on modern Windows and Mac machines.

This connectivity turns what looks like a simple “drum pad machine” into a legitimate entry-level production tool. We found that users who were interested in making their own music electronically found this feature particularly valuable. While it doesn’t replace a professional MIDI controller with weighted pads, it is more than enough for a hobbyist or a student to start learning the basics of digital music production. What Other Users Are Saying

The general consensus among users is overwhelmingly positive, especially regarding its value as a gift for children. Many parents have noted that it is a “neat little machine” that genuinely helps in learning the basics of drumming. One user highlighted that the colored lighting and special effects are highly effective at holding a 6-year-old’s attention, which is no small feat in the age of digital distractions. Others have praised its durability, stating it is “durable enough for babies and children” while performing its intended functions perfectly. Grandparents also seem to love it as a birthday surprise, noting the “really nice quality product and sound.”

However, no product is without its criticisms. We found some consistent reports regarding the foot pedals. One user mentioned that their hi-hat pedal stopped working almost immediately, while the bass pedal occasionally triggered double sounds. Another user reported a very concerning issue regarding an electrical shock after a day of use, alongside some pads failing. While these negative experiences seem to be outliers or related to specific defective units, they highlight the importance of checking your unit thoroughly upon arrival. Most users find the experience seamless, but it is worth noting that the pedal sensitivity and internal wiring quality can vary between units.
